Bird completes all-British McLaren driver pairing

The NEOM McLaren Formula E Team have finally announced the signing of Sam Bird for season 10, to replace the outgoing René Rast.

It was confirmed by the Woking-based team last week that Rast would be departing after just one season with the side. Bird is a solid replacement for the German, with the British driver having left Jaguar TCS Racing following the conclusion of season nine.

The Formula E veteran spent three seasons with Jaguar prior to his switch to McLaren, which’ll see him partner Jake Hughes in what is an all-British line-up for the British team.

Bird is one of a few drivers to have competed in every season in the all-electric series, meaning he’ll bring an extensive amount of experience to McLaren, who have just finished their first season in the championship.

A change of scenery was needed for Bird, who’s time at Jaguar failed to live up to its expectations. Despite this, he remains as one of the quickest drivers on the grid, as proven in 2023, a year which saw him claim four podiums.

He’s “super excited” to have joined an outfit with “so much heritage and prestige” and is “super motivated” to help McLaren progress to the front of the field.

“I’m super excited to get going with the NEOM McLaren Formula E Team,” Bird said.

“Becoming part of a team with so much heritage and prestige as the McLaren Racing family feels special. We know there is some work to do ahead of Season 10, to ensure we get to where we want to be, which is at the front of the Formula E pack.

“It feels great to be part of the team and I can’t wait to kick off the season preparations, I’m super motivated and driven to deliver success with the team in Season 10.”

McLaren’s package proved to be quick over one-lap last season, but it lacked in race trim. Energy efficiency wasn’t their strong point, something which resulted in Rast claiming the team’s only podium in Diriyah, Saudi Arabia.

They ultimately ended the 2022/23 season P8 in the Constructors’ Championship, a spot they can finish well above if they can improve their race performance. This is where Bird’s experience will be vital, with Team Principal Ian James having revealed how the British driver is super hungry to get started on McLaren’s 2024 preparations.

“It’s great to be able to share the news that Sam will be joining the team for Season 10, alongside Jake,” said James.

“Sam is a proven force in Formula E, as well as other categories of racing, and his experience and determination will fuel the team ahead of an exciting season to come.

As soon as the deal was done, his first question to me was when he could come into the office to start the preparations for Season 10 – this clearly shows his hunger and commitment to making Season 10 a success for the NEOM McLaren Formula E Team. Having both Sam and Jake on board has already instilled confidence in the team.”
